Latest Patents

Among Hiroaki Yoda's latest innovations is a "Pressure Test Method of Double Suction Volute Pump." This invention introduces a design where flat faces serving as sealing points are formed on the circumferential edges of division plates that define the suction chambers within a volute casing. It also incorporates a bolt fastening structure that enhances the reliability of the assembly.

Another notable patent is the "Magnetic Separation Unit and Water Purification System." This technology aims to stabilize magnetic separation performance by preventing magnetic flocs from obstructing the water channel in pipes. The system utilizes an air-core solenoid type magnet and a rotating disc type magnetic filter case to efficiently attract and manage contaminants in treated water.
